diff options
| author | Yukihiro "Matz" Matsumoto <[email protected]> | 2019-06-11 09:36:15 +0900 |
|---|---|---|
| committer | GitHub <[email protected]> | 2019-06-11 09:36:15 +0900 |
| commit | 313059d08ca95f9fee4e2b00f218cb21ea83418c (patch) | |
| tree | e61a481b456ff7f25ec9b2705d261a8e6d0f4588 | |
| parent | 04999e969f9cb0dcf70e313caae52f115163ab95 (diff) | |
| parent | f8f75fc9c66d834fa81632b113dad5713e2b42b4 (diff) | |
| download | mruby-313059d08ca95f9fee4e2b00f218cb21ea83418c.tar.gz mruby-313059d08ca95f9fee4e2b00f218cb21ea83418c.zip | |
Merge pull request #4496 from dearblue/replace-obsolete
Replace obsolete macros
| -rw-r--r-- | mrbgems/mruby-io/src/file_test.c | 2 | ||||
| -rw-r--r-- | mrbgems/mruby-io/src/io.c |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/mrbgems/mruby-io/src/file_test.c b/mrbgems/mruby-io/src/file_test.c index 5d5ecb93f..85a221ff9 100644 --- a/mrbgems/mruby-io/src/file_test.c +++ b/mrbgems/mruby-io/src/file_test.c @@ -44,7 +44,7 @@ mrb_stat0(mrb_state *mrb, mrb_value obj, struct stat *st, int do_lstat) { if (mrb_obj_is_kind_of(mrb, obj, mrb_class_get(mrb, "IO"))) { struct mrb_io *fptr; - fptr = (struct mrb_io *)mrb_get_datatype(mrb, obj, &mrb_io_type); + fptr = (struct mrb_io *)mrb_data_get_ptr(mrb, obj, &mrb_io_type); if (fptr && fptr->fd >= 0) { return fstat(fptr->fd, st); diff --git a/mrbgems/mruby-io/src/io.c b/mrbgems/mruby-io/src/io.c index e5b83e923..99441f16b 100644 --- a/mrbgems/mruby-io/src/io.c +++ b/mrbgems/mruby-io/src/io.c @@ -79,7 +79,7 @@ io_get_open_fptr(mrb_state *mrb, mrb_value self) { struct mrb_io *fptr; - fptr = (struct mrb_io *)mrb_get_datatype(mrb, self, &mrb_io_type); + fptr = (struct mrb_io *)mrb_data_get_ptr(mrb, self, &mrb_io_type); if (fptr == NULL) { mrb_raise(mrb, E_IO_ERROR, "uninitialized stream."); } @@ -955,7 +955,7 @@ mrb_value mrb_io_closed(mrb_state *mrb, mrb_value io) { struct mrb_io *fptr; - fptr = (struct mrb_io *)mrb_get_datatype(mrb, io, &mrb_io_type); + fptr = (struct mrb_io *)mrb_data_get_ptr(mrb, io, &mrb_io_type); if (fptr == NULL || fptr->fd >= 0) { return mrb_false_value(); } |
